Si3Mo5 is a transition metal silicide compound combining silicon and molybdenum, belonging to the family of refractory intermetallic materials. This material exhibits a dense crystalline structure typical of high-temperature ceramic-metal composites and is of primary interest in research and advanced materials development rather than widespread industrial production. Its stiffness and thermal stability make it a candidate for extreme-environment applications, though it remains largely in the experimental phase compared to established alternatives like MoSi2 or conventional superalloys.
